Country Star Jelly Roll Announces He’s Leaving X (Formerly Twitter): ‘The Most Toxic Negative App To Exist Ever’
Jelly Roll is over X.
The country singing sensation took to the social media app (formerly known as Twitter), to announce that he would no longer be on the platform.
He wrote on Sunday (October 20),
“This is for sure the most toxic negative app to exist ever — PERIOD. lol.”
He added that the app, which Elon Musk bought in October 2022 before changing the name, is “different.”
“This place is different man, I always heard it was the Wild West on here but man it’s insane .”
He added,
“It’s a safe place for everyone to say mean sh*t to each other with no consequences. I’m out lol”
